MOOCs and Open Education Around the World is a
book
which
studies
issues
related to open
educational resources
(OERs) and
massive open online courses (MOOCs).
Recent
changes in
technology-enhanced learning have provided the means for
learners
all around the world
to take part in online classes.
These online MOOC courses are
normally free
but do not
consistently
lead to formal accreditation.
